Course Content

• Introduction to Energy Sector Regulations & Policy
• Electricity Market Design and Regulation
• Natural Gas Regulation and Infrastructure
• Renewable Energy Policy and Incentives (including feed-in tariffs & RPS)
• Energy Efficiency Standards and Programs
• Environmental Regulations in the Energy Sector (emissions trading, carbon capture)
• Energy Security and Geopolitics
• Regulation of Energy Storage and Smart Grid Technologies
• The Role of Competition in Energy Markets
• Dispute Resolution and Enforcement in Energy Regulation

Career path

Career Role Description
Energy Regulatory Affairs Manager (UK) Leads regulatory compliance, shaping energy policy and ensuring legal adherence across the UK energy sector. High-level strategic role.
Energy Compliance Officer (UK) Ensures ongoing compliance with energy sector regulations, including reporting and risk management. Crucial role for maintaining compliance.
Renewable Energy Consultant (UK) Advises businesses on renewable energy options, strategies, and regulatory frameworks in the UK. Growing demand in the green energy transition.
Energy Market Analyst (UK) Analyzes energy market trends, regulations, and their impacts on pricing and competition in the UK. Critical for market forecasting.
Sustainability & Energy Manager (UK) Develops and implements sustainability strategies aligning with UK energy regulations and minimizing environmental impact. Increasingly vital role.
